abstract = {Icing simulation of a 30P30N multi-element airfoil is conducted to explore the aerodynamic characteristics influenced by ice shape on the multi-element airfoil under different inflow conditions. An improved multi-time step calculation method based on the Myers icing phase transition model is proposed. A robust and efficient Lagrangian water collection calculation is realized by introducing the minimum wall distance. The local mesh repair technique is applied to improve the robustness of mesh reconstruction under complex ice conditions. The calculation results show that the ice shape is distributed at the leading edge of the slat airfoil and the lower surface of the main element and the flap airfoil. The droplet collection on the multi-element airfoil surface has significant unsteady characteristics due to the influence of the upstream component wake. Ice accretion on the leading edge slat and ice blocking in the crack near the slat are the main factors leading to the aerodynamic performance degradation, while the ice on the flap surface has a smaller impact for the lift and drag efficiency.}
